Write an equation of a line that passes through (-2,3) and (0,8)

Respuesta :

gmany
gmany gmany
  • 02-11-2018

The slope-intercept form:

[tex]y=mx+b\\\\m=\dfrac{y_2-y_1}{x_2-x_1}-slope\\\\b-y-intercept\ (0,\ b)[/tex]

We have the points (-2, 3) and (0, 8) → b = 8. Substitute:

[tex]m=\dfrac{8-3}{0-(-2)}=\dfrac{5}{2}=2.5\\\\y=2.5x+8[/tex]
